Very disappointing experience on Splendor out of Sydney

Review for a South Pacific Cruise on Carnival Splendor

User Avatar
eddie28
First Time Cruiser • Age 30s

Very hard-working crew but simply too many people on the ship. At capacity of 3,700 guests, queues remained way too long for food, activities and tendering. Two small, cold pools (one adult only) completely insufficient for number on board and space outdoors and undercover are scarce. Kids/Teens clubs were inaccessible and poor. Visible signs of recent renovation were not obvious – still looked ...
